44:1  The word that came to Jeremiah for all the Jews living in the land of Egypt, those who had lived in Migdol, Tahpanhes, Memphis, and the land of Pathros, saying,

44:2  "Thus says the LORD of hosts, the God of Israel, 'You yourselves have seen all the calamity that I have brought on Jerusalem and all the cities of Judah; and behold, this day they have fallen into ruins and no one lives in them,

44:3   because of their wickedness which they committed so as to provoke Me to anger by continuing to burn sacrifices and to serve other gods whom they had not known, neither they, you, nor your fathers.

44:4  'Yet I sent you all My servants the prophets, again and again, saying, "Oh, do not do this abominable thing which I hate."

44:5  'But they did not listen or incline their ears to turn from their wickedness, so as not to burn sacrifices to other gods.

44:6  'Therefore I poured out My wrath and My anger and burned in the cities of Judah and in the streets of Jerusalem, so they have become a ruin and a desolation as it still occurs to this day.

44:7  'Now then thus says the LORD God of hosts, the God of Israel, "Why have you done great harm to yourselves, so as to cut off from you man and woman, child and infant, from among Judah, leaving yourselves without remnant,

44:9  "Have you forgotten the wickedness of your fathers, the wickedness of the kings of Judah, and the wickedness of their wives, your own wickedness, and the wickedness of your wives, which they committed in the land of Judah and in the streets of Jerusalem?

44:10  "But they have not become contrite even to this day, nor have they feared nor walked in My law or My statutes, which I have set before you and before your fathers."'

44:11  "Therefore thus says the LORD of hosts, the God of Israel, 'Behold, I intend to set My face against you for woe, even to cut off all Judah.

44:12  'And I will take away the remnant of Judah who have set their mind on entering the land of Egypt to reside there, and they will all meet their end in the land of Egypt; they will fall by the sword and meet their end by famine Both small and great will die by the sword and famine; and they will become a curse, an object of horror, an imprecation and a reproach.

44:13  'And I will punish those who live in the land of Egypt, as I have punished Jerusalem, with the sword, with famine and with pestilence.

44:14  'So you will have no refugees or survivors for the remnant of Judah who have entered the land of Egypt to reside there and then to return to the land of Judah, to which they long to return and live; for none will return except a few refugees.'"

44:15  Then all the men who had become aware that their wives burned sacrifices to other gods, along with all the women who stood by, as a large assembly, including all the people who lived in Pathros in the land of Egypt, responded to Jeremiah, saying,

44:16  "As for the message that you have spoken to us in the name of the LORD, we do not intend to listen to you!

44:17  "But rather we will certainly carry out every word that has proceeded from our mouths, by burning sacrifices to the queen of heaven and pouring out drink offerings to her, just as we ourselves, our forefathers, our kings and our princes did in the cities of Judah and in the streets of Jerusalem; for then we had plenty of food and seemed well off and saw no misfortune.

44:18  "But since we stopped burning sacrifices to the queen of heaven and pouring out drink offerings to her, we have lacked everything and have met our end by the sword and by famine."

44:19  "And," said the women, "when we burned sacrifices to the queen of heaven and poured out drink offerings to her, did we do it without our husbands that we made for her sacrificial cakes in her image and poured out drink offerings to her?"

44:20  Then Jeremiah said to all the people, to the men and women--even to all the people who gave him such an answer--saying,

44:21  "As for the smoking sacrifices that you burned in the cities of Judah and in the streets of Jerusalem, you and your forefathers, your kings and your princes, and the people of the land, did not the LORD remember them and did not all this come into His mind?

44:22  "So the LORD could no longer endure it, because of the evil of your deeds, because of the abominations which you have committed; thus your land has become a ruin, an object of horror and a curse, without an inhabitant, as it occurs to this day.

44:23  "Because you have burned sacrifices and have sinned against the LORD and not obeyed the voice of the LORD or walked in His law, His statutes or His testimonies, therefore this calamity has befallen you, as it has this day."

44:24  Then Jeremiah said to all the people, including all the women, " Hear the word of the LORD, all Judah who live in the land of Egypt,

44:25  thus says the LORD of hosts, the God of Israel, as follows: 'As for you and your wives, you have spoken with your mouths and fulfilled it with your hands, saying, "We will certainly perform our vows that we have vowed, to burn sacrifices to the queen of heaven and pour out drink offerings to her " Go ahead and confirm your vows, and certainly perform your vows!'

44:26  "Nevertheless hear the word of the LORD, all Judah who live in the land of Egypt, 'Behold, I have sworn by My great name,' says the LORD, ' never shall any man of Judah invoke My name in all the land of Egypt, saying, " As the Lord GOD lives."

44:27  'Behold, I watch over them for harm and not for good, and all the men of Judah who dwell in the land of Egypt will meet their end by the sword and by famine until they completely disappear.

44:28  ' Those who escape the sword will return out of the land of Egypt to the land of Judah few in number Then all the remnant of Judah who have gone to the land of Egypt to reside there will know whose word will stand, Mine or theirs.

44:29  'This I will give as a sign to you,' declares the LORD, 'that I intend to punish you in this place, so that you may know that My words will surely stand against you for harm.'

44:30  "Thus says the LORD, 'Behold, I intend to give over Pharaoh Hophra king of Egypt to the hand of his enemies, to the hand of those who seek his life, just as I gave over Zedekiah king of Judah to the hand of Nebuchadnezzar king of Babylon, who remained his enemy and sought his life.'"
